Whitby, BR poster, 1958

Poster produced by British Railways (BR) to pomote rail services to Whitby, gem of the Yorkshire Coast. Artwork by an unknown artist

EDITORS COMMENTS
This print takes us back to the enchanting coastal town of Whitby in 1958, as captured by an unknown artist commissioned by British Railways (BR). The poster was created with the sole purpose of promoting rail services to this gem on the Yorkshire Coast. The artwork beautifully depicts a picturesque scene, showcasing Whitby's irresistible charm and natural beauty. Nestled between rolling hills and overlooking a serene sea, this quaint seaside destination is truly a sight to behold. The vibrant colors used in the poster bring life to its iconic landmarks; from the majestic ruins of Whitby Abbey perched atop East Cliff, to the bustling harbor where fishing boats bob gently on calm waters.
